Job description

The Senior Specialist, Insurance Education & Engagement / Inside Sales Representative , develops contacts and business relationships with schools and universities, & other local student societies and associations. This position engages and educates members, students, about the role and importance, value, and capabilities of the Association Insurance products and services. How you will make a difference

  • Identifying opportunities to present and educate students, and members on the importance of insurance products and services available through the association
  • Creating and delivering presentations, coordinating events and seminars, and developing social media presence and communications.
  • Identifying opportunities to sell Insurance products while also identifying the need for deeper reviews for insurance advice, referring members seeking advice to advisors in order to meet certain team goals and targets.
  • Developing and implementing an Education and Engagement plan to ensure targets are met for events, outreach and application goals.
  • Coordinating and maintaining a schedule of planned educational and engagement initiatives.
  • Researching, collecting and providing insights to internal and external stakeholders from market interactions, including competitive intelligence, environmental issues, membership, educational and licensing requirements, and other issues that may impact members and Insurance's ability to achieve its goals.

Requirements that are important to us

  • University Degree or College Diploma in Finance, Commerce, Marketing, Business Administration
  • Three to four years of relevant experience creating and delivering presentations to large groups of people.
  • Possess the Life License Qualification Program (LLQP) Certificate
  • intermediate to advanced presentation, content development and communications skills, leadership, public speaking skills and consultation skills.
  • Valid Ontario Driver’s license with access to a registered vehicle with some travel within Ontario required
  • Group and individual insurance knowledge an asset
  • Sales, Business Development and Marketing experience
  • Knowledge with retirement product such as RRSP, TFSA, annuities, and retirement planning knowledge is an asset.

Permanent hybrid work environment. As such, the individual in this position will be required to work a minimum number of days in our Toronto office. This position also requires travel within the assigned region on an as-needed basis (approx 40%) with some overnight travel (5-10%)
